Can irises be grown hydroponically?

Iris can be grown hydroponically or in soil. The soil method can provide relatively stable nutrients to promote the growth of the plants. The hydroponic method is relatively clean and suitable for display at home for viewing. In comparison, irises are more suitable for soil cultivation.

Iris hydroponic cultivation method

1. Pruning and disinfection: When growing irises in water, the roots need to be pruned, and particularly long roots need to be trimmed. Old and rotten roots also need to be cut off. The roots should then be disinfected and sterilized, washed with clean water, and left to dry naturally.

2. Prepare containers : When growing irises in water, you need to prepare suitable hydroponic containers. You can choose transparent glass containers, which can better observe the growth of the roots.

Precautions for growing irises in water

1. Temperature: During the hydroponic culture process, irises should be placed in a place with diffuse light. The suitable temperature for irises is between 20 and 23 degrees. In an environment with high temperature and weak light, it is easy to cause it to wither.

2. Fertilization : In the early stage of hydroponics, iris needs to be replaced with clean water every 2 to 3 days. After new roots grow, add nutrient solution for cultivation. The nutrient solution should be replaced about every two weeks.
